When booking professional headshots in Manhattanville, it's essential to compare several factors beyond just price. First, assess the photographer's portfolio fit to ensure their style aligns with your desired professional image, whether it's corporate, creative, or natural, and look for consistency in their work. Next, clarify the turnaround time for receiving your final, retouched images, as this can range from a few days to a couple of weeks depending on the complexity of editing and the photographer's workflow. Understanding usage rights is crucial; photographers typically retain copyright, granting you a license for specific uses (e.g., personal, commercial, social media), so discuss these terms upfront. Inquire about their retouching approach to ensure it enhances your appearance naturally without looking over-edited. Finally, understand their delivery workflow, which often involves an online gallery for selections and digital delivery of high-resolution files.
Headshot sessions can vary, but typically range from 15 minutes for a quick, single-look session to 1-2 hours for multiple outfits and backgrounds, depending on your needs and the photographer's style.
Opt for clean, well-fitted clothing in solid colors that reflect your professional brand. Avoid busy patterns, as they can be distracting, and consider bringing a few outfit options to allow for variety and ensure you feel confident.
Most photographers provide an online gallery of proofs for you to select your favorite images. The final retouched images are then delivered, but typically, the raw or unedited files are not included in standard packages, as photographers retain copyright and deliver a finished product.
The cost for professional headshots in NYC can vary widely based on the photographer's experience, the number of looks, session length, and included retouched images.
